1036519 Gold Cigar Box presented to H R H The Prince of Wales by Actors and Managers of London Theatres, 9 November 1891 (engraving) by English School, (19th century); Private Collection; (add.info.: Gold Cigar Box presented to H R H The Prince of Wales by Actors and Managers of London Theatres, 9 November 1891. Illustration for The Graphic, 14 November 1891.); Look and Learn / Illustrated Papers Collection
